A colleague of mine is having trouble with a brand new Logic 9 installation on a brand new 12 core Mac running OS 10.6.8 and I can't quite seem to get to the bottom of it. 

He is having a sort of "latency" between the metering in his AU plug-ins (either third party or native Logic) and the sound of the audio. I've had him check the obvious things; but it has been inconclusive thus far. So far he has tried the following: 

* Turning all latency compensation off. 

* Trying various buffer settings. 

* Removing any potential latency inducing plug-ins from the main outputs. 

* Running with the Mac built in audio (no difference). 

* He has run the same AU plug-ins in Reaper and not had this problem.
